Latest Patents

Stevens holds a patent for a "Method and system for priority based telephone call screening." This invention provides a method for managing incoming telephone calls by associating each call with a telephone number. The system allows users to select a time constraint, telephone use status, and treatment option to assign a priority code to selected numbers. The priority code is determined based on the timing of the incoming call and the user's telephone use status. This innovative method enhances the management of incoming calls according to the assigned treatment options.
